Ohio Surgery Centers Plan October ‘Advocacy Day’ in DC

The Ohio Association of Ambulatory Surgery Centers is joining with the ASC Association to hold an ASC “Advocacy Day” in Washington, D.C., on Oct. 13, according to an OAASC report.

Advertisement

 

The event, which is just for Ohio ASCs, begins with a fundraiser event for Sen. Sherrod Brown and will include meetings with Ohio Congressional members and staff.
